What is Dstack?
dstack 是款 AI 工具,可簡化訓練、微調和部署生成式 AI 模型的流程。它活用了開放原始碼生態系統,並提供方便的 CLI 和 API,以便與任何雲端供應商相容。有了 dstack,開發人員可以在提交長時間任務或部署模型前,在他們的 IDE、終端機或 Jupyter 筆記本中互動式地進行實驗。此工具還提供一種簡單的方法來執行任務,例如在已設定的雲端 GPU 供應商上訓練或微調指令碼,進而加速訓練。此外,dstack 簡化了模型或網路應用程式的部署,處理已設定雲端 GPU 供應商上的流程並提供公開 HTTPS 端點。
主要特色:
簡化的開發:
在提交長時間任務或部署模型前,在 IDE、終端機或 Jupyter 筆記本中互動式地進行實驗。
單一指令即可提供必要的雲端資源、程式碼和環境。
加速訓練:
輕鬆在已設定的雲端 GPU 供應商上執行任務,例如訓練或微調指令碼。
指定指令、埠,並選擇 Python 版本或 Docker image 以執行。
dstack 會在已設定的雲端 GPU 供應商上執行,具備必要的資源。
可擴展的部署:
輕鬆部署模型或網路應用程式。
指定指令、埠,並選擇 Python 版本或 Docker image。
dstack 會在已設定的雲端 GPU 供應商上處理部署,並提供公開 HTTPS 端點。
用例:
研究人員和開發人員可以使用 dstack 來簡化訓練和微調生成式 AI 模型的流程。他們可以在他們偏好的開發環境中互動式地進行實驗,並輕鬆為他們的建置提供必要的資源。
希望部署 AI 模型或網路應用程式的公司或個人可以使用 dstack 來簡化部署流程。他們可以指定必要的指令和設定,而 dstack 會在已設定的雲端 GPU 供應商上處理部署,並提供公開 HTTPS 端點。
結論:
dstack 是一款強大的 AI 工具,可簡化生成式 AI 模型的訓練、微調和部署。它的主要特色包含簡化的開發、加速訓練和可擴展的部署,使其成為研究人員、開發人員和公司的一項寶貴資產。有了 dstack,使用者可以簡化他們的 AI 工作流程,並獲得更快、更有效率的結果。





